The Declaration of Independence’s list of grievances includes the suppression of the right to a jury trial. Learn how the jury right gradually arose and developed over the centuries in England, and how it became a keystone to justice and liberty. Highlights include the trials of Quaker leader and founder of Pennsylvania William Penn in England and printer John Peter Zenger in New York. Learn how Patrick Henry's appeal to the jury in the Parsons Cause solidified the jury in American lore and launched Henry’s career. Discover how England's oppression of the colonies consistently deprived the colonists of the right to a jury and why suppressing it is a key threat to unalienable rights.
The grievances also include shipping criminal defendants overseas to face hostile trials. With the expansion of the Vice Admiralty Courts and similar mechanisms, criminals defendants were uprooted from their communities and shipped to face justice before tribunals ready to convict. Understand how that too threatened justice and unalienable rights.
Discover how the Quebec Act governing Canada abolished representative government, the common law of England, and jury trials. Explore why the Quebec Act was considered a betrayal of the colonists and perceived to be a tremendous threat to the the First Principles of the rule of law, unalienable rights, limited government, and the Social Compact.
